Understanding Food Temperature Preservation

Keeping food at the right temperature is more than just a convenience—it’s about maintaining food quality, taste, and most importantly, preventing bacterial growth. Keeping food warm containers come in various designs and technologies, each tailored to specific needs and situations.

Types of Food Warming Containers

Several container types excel at maintaining food temperature:

  • Thermal Lunch Boxes: Designed with multiple insulation layers to trap heat
  • Stainless Steel Thermos Containers: Ideal for soups, stews, and liquid-based dishes
  • Electric Heated Containers: Powered options for long-term temperature maintenance
  • Vacuum-Insulated Containers: Advanced technology preventing heat loss

Key Features to Consider

When selecting keeping food warm containers, consider these critical features:

  • Insulation Quality: Multiple layers provide better heat retention
  • Material Durability: Stainless steel and high-grade plastics offer longevity
  • Size and Capacity: Match container size to your typical food portions
  • Seal Integrity: Tight-fitting lids prevent heat escape

Practical Tips for Maintaining Food Temperature

Maximize your container’s performance with these professional strategies:

  • Preheat containers by filling with hot water for 5 minutes before adding food
  • Use aluminum foil as an additional insulation layer
  • Pack hot foods immediately after cooking
  • Avoid opening containers frequently to retain heat

🔥 Note: Always check food temperature with a food thermometer to ensure it remains above 140°F (60°C) to prevent bacterial growth.

How long can food stay warm in these containers?


+


Most high-quality thermal containers can keep food warm for 4-6 hours, depending on insulation quality and initial food temperature.






Are electric food warmers better than traditional thermal containers?


+


Electric food warmers provide continuous heating but are less portable. Thermal containers are more versatile and don’t require electricity.






Can these containers keep food cold as well?


+


Many vacuum-insulated and thermal containers are designed to maintain both hot and cold temperatures effectively.
